Nonamesset Island is the most easterly of the Elizabeth Islands of Dukes County, Massachusetts, United States. The island has a land area of 1.398 km² (0.54 sq mi or 345.5 acres) and was uninhabited as of the 2000 census.[2] The island is part of the town of Gosnold, Massachusetts.

Painter Robert Swain Gifford was born on the island in 1840.[3]
